The below graph shows the average terraced house price in the Crawley local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The five 19 ALPHA ROAD sales between June 2002 and October 2024 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the January 2018 sale was for 1% below the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 1% below the HPI over time, until the October 2024 sale, where it falls to 9% below the HPI. The line then continues to track at 9% below the HPI.
